They regulate the sport hunting of invasive exotic species in Corrientes

The **Corrientes Natural Resources Department** established [new provisions](https://noticiasambientales.com/medio-ambiente/caza-en-la-pampa-mas-de-1-200-extranjeros-llegaron-en-2024/) for the sport hunting of wild boar (Sus scrofa) and axis deer (Axis axis), both species considered invasive and harmful to the ecosystem and agricultural production.

Directive No. 248 responds to the need to update the criteria for hunting permits, addressing the demands of sports hunters and the concerns of rural producers affected by the [proliferation of these species](https://noticiasambientales.com/medio-ambiente/caza-en-la-pampa-mas-de-1-200-extranjeros-llegaron-en-2024/).

The new regulations aim to [facilitate the population control](https://noticiasambientales.com/medio-ambiente/caza-en-la-pampa-mas-de-1-200-extranjeros-llegaron-en-2024/) of these animals, allowing hunters to [increase the number of specimens hunted](https://noticiasambientales.com/medio-ambiente/caza-en-la-pampa-mas-de-1-200-extranjeros-llegaron-en-2024/). Hunting will be allowed from [Monday to Sunday](https://noticiasambientales.com/medio-ambiente/caza-en-la-pampa-mas-de-1-200-extranjeros-llegaron-en-2024/), excluding protected areas, parks, and reserves. Regarding restrictions, the [quota for axis deer is eliminated](https://noticiasambientales.com/medio-ambiente/caza-en-la-pampa-mas-de-1-200-extranjeros-llegaron-en-2024/), meaning that hunters will be able to hunt [without limits on quantity or sex distinctions](https://noticiasambientales.com/medio-ambiente/caza-en-la-pampa-mas-de-1-200-extranjeros-llegaron-en-2024/). For wild boar, the regulations maintain the elimination of any type of restriction on its hunting.

Furthermore, the movement of hunted axis deer within the province is authorized [without the need for seals](https://noticiasambientales.com/medio-ambiente/caza-en-la-pampa-mas-de-1-200-extranjeros-llegaron-en-2024/), although seals will be mandatory for [interjurisdictional transfers](https://noticiasambientales.com/medio-ambiente/caza-en-la-pampa-mas-de-1-200-extranjeros-llegaron-en-2024/). For wild boar, the exemption from seals is maintained both within and outside the province.

**Economic Impact and Hunting Tourism**

The **Corrientes Natural Resources Department** highlighted that while the proliferation of these species causes [serious damage to producers](https://noticiasambientales.com/medio-ambiente/caza-en-la-pampa-mas-de-1-200-extranjeros-llegaron-en-2024/), sports hunting also represents an [important source of income](https://noticiasambientales.com/medio-ambiente/caza-en-la-pampa-mas-de-1-200-extranjeros-llegaron-en-2024/) for many communities in the interior.

In this sense, the activity has allowed various producers to diversify their income sources through hunting tourism, an alternative that has gained importance amid adversities such as [droughts, fires, and floods](https://noticiasambientales.com/medio-ambiente/caza-en-la-pampa-mas-de-1-200-extranjeros-llegaron-en-2024/). Additionally, the arrival of hunters and tourists has a [positive impact on the local economy](https://noticiasambientales.com/medio-ambiente/caza-en-la-pampa-mas-de-1-200-extranjeros-llegaron-en-2024/), benefiting [tour operators, businesses, and the province in general](https://noticiasambientales.com/medio-ambiente/caza-en-la-pampa-mas-de-1-200-extranjeros-llegaron-en-2024/).

**Requirements and Penalties**

To participate in sports hunting, interested parties must have:

– A valid hunting license.
– Permission from the landowner, issued by the Natural Resources Department.
– Authorization to enter the establishment for all members of the hunting party.

The regulations establish that any species not authorized for hunting is considered protected. In case of illegal hunting, the [confiscation of the hunt](https://noticiasambientales.com/medio-ambiente/caza-en-la-pampa-mas-de-1-200-extranjeros-llegaron-en-2024/), [seizure of weapons](https://noticiasambientales.com/medio-ambiente/caza-en-la-pampa-mas-de-1-200-extranjeros-llegaron-en-2024/), and [application of sanctions](https://noticiasambientales.com/medio-ambiente/caza-en-la-pampa-mas-de-1-200-extranjeros-llegaron-en-2024/) according to the law will be carried out.

Finally, it is clarified that the **Corrientes Natural Resources Department** will be the only authorized body for issuing permits, both for landowners with commercial purposes and those without profit motives.
